概述
基于电位器的旋转角度传感器,旋转角度从0到300度,与Arduino传感器扩展板结合使用,可以非常容易地实现与旋转位置相关的互动效果或制作MIDI乐器。
技术规格
- 供电电压:3.3~5v
- 输出类型:模拟信号
- 接口模式:PH2.0-3p
- 转动角度:300°
- 外形尺寸:22x27mm
- 重量:10g
引脚定义
传感器引脚的定义是
1.输出信号
2.地(GND)
3.电源(VCC)
连接示意图
示例代码
// # Editor : Lauren from DFRobot
// # Date : 30.12.2011
// #
// # Editor : Lauren from DFRobot
// # Date : 17.01.2012
// # Product name: Rotation Sensor v1/v2 or Analog Slide Position Sensor
// # Product SKU : DFR0054/DFR0058/DFR0053
// # Version : 1.0
// # Description:
// # the sample to drive some analog sensors
// # Connection:
// # Signal output pin -> Analog pin 0
// #
void setup()
{
Serial.begin(9600); //Set serial baud rate to 9600 bps
}
void loop()
{
int val;
val=analogRead(0); //Read slider value from analog 0
Serial.println(val,DEC);//Print the value to serial port
delay(100);
}
Mind+(基于Scratch3.0图形化编程)
1、下载及安装软件。下载地址:http://www.mindplus.cc 详细教程:Mind+基础wiki教程-软件下载安装
2、切换到“上传模式”。 详细教程:Mind+基础wiki教程-上传模式编程流程
3、“扩展”中选择“主控板”中的“Arduino Uno”。 详细教程:Mind+基础wiki教程-加载扩展库流程
4、进行编程,程序如下图:
5、菜单“连接设备”,“上传到设备”
6、程序上传完毕后,打开串口即可看到数据输出。详细教程:Mind+基础wiki教程-串口打印